The average price of a 7-day trip to Mottola is $1,255 for a solo traveler, $2,254 for a couple, and $4,226 for a family of 4. Mottola hotels range from $38 to $174 per night with an average of $49, while most vacation rentals will cost $140 to $420 per night for the entire home. Average worldwide flight costs to Bari Airport (BRI) are between $585 and $998 per person for economy flights and $1,836 to $3,132 for first class. Depending on activities, we recommend budgeting $34 to $64 per person per day for transportation and enjoying local restaurants.

See below for average, budget, and luxury trip costs. You can also look up flight costs from your airport for more tailored flight pricing.

 

 

The Cheapest Times to Visit Mottola, IT

On average, these will be the cheapest dates to fly to BRI and stay in a Mottola hotel:

  • January 1st to April 1st
  • September 10th to December 9th (except the week of October 22nd)

The absolute cheapest time to take a vacation in Mottola is usually late January and early February.

Daily Expenses Budget

Daily vacation expenses vary more based on what you’re interested in doing. A fine dining restaurant with drinks around Mottola can easily cost $220 per person or more, while a standard nice meal might be about $14 per person. Private tours can cost $433 per day, but self-guided tours to see the outdoor sights can be free. Costs vary wildly, so recommendations are made based on the cost of living and averages we see for this type of vacation.
